Transaction 423086375cb3435ed92fcddc87d500df79ce44e5debb8aaddfeb7cdc37af958c

1 Input
2 Outputs
  • 423086375cb3435ed92fcddc87d500df79ce44e5debb8aaddfeb7cdc37af958c:0
  • value  93467
    address  3P2RdEmXrStCWDtguP7MfCtcSoM3DUYNFU
  • 423086375cb3435ed92fcddc87d500df79ce44e5debb8aaddfeb7cdc37af958c:1
  • value  801741
    address  1CcksyGsZXbBFh9U1px6KfEL5ATDaDxDdd